What is Git?

- Distributed version control system

- Designed for the challenges of large-scale open-source projects

- Supports fast, off-line work

Centralized Version Control

One central code repository

Requires a connection to perform most operations Check out

Commit

Merge

Branch

View History

Can retrieve just the files you need

Limited capability for offline work

Conceptually simple

Distributed Version Control

No central code repository Central repository is defined by convention

Does not require a connection

Can only retrieve an entire repository

Higher learning curve

Why Distributed?

Work fully offline

Encourages frequent commits

Easy to switch work

Powerful tools for viewing and rewriting history

Increasingly popular

Why Not Distributed?

Harder to use day-to-day

Few non-OSS projects need the ability to rewrite history

Git does not handle binaries well

Security is defined at the repository level

Should you make the switch?

Yes, if:

- You work offline frequently

- Your software is open-source

- You want to branch and merge frequently

Should you make the switch?

No, if:

- You never work offline

- Your software is closed-source

- Developers are productive and happy using something else

- You require stringent code security

Best Practices Don’t Panic

Do not put binaries in Git repositories!

Manage binary dependencies via a package manager

Keep repos small (one repo == one application)

Branch early, branch often. Don’t work directly on master.
